Is Nissin Soup, Ramen Noodle, Chicken Flavor, 5 Pack Dairy Free?

Description
Five pack chicken flavored instant noodles offer brothy, savory flavor with soft, springy strands when cooked; commonly prepared as a quick soup or base for added vegetables. Reviews note convenience, low cost, and consistent taste, with occasional comments on saltiness and simplicity suitable for fast meals or snacks and portability.

Ingredients
Enriched Flour (Wheat Flour, Niacin, Reduced Iron, Thiamine Mononitrate, Riboflavin, Folic Acid), Palm Oil, Salt, Contains Less Than 2% Of Autolyzed Yeast Extract, Calcium Silicate, Citric Acid, Disodium Guanylate, Disodium Inosinate, Dried Leek Flake, Garlic Powder, Hydrolyzed Corn Protein, Hydrolyzed Soy Protein, Maltodextrin, Monosodium Glutamate, Natural And Artificial Flavor, Onion Powder, Potassium Carbonate, Powdered Chicken, Rendered Chicken Fat, Sodium Alginate, Sodium Carbonate, Sodium Tripolyphosphate, Soybean, Spice And Color, Sugar, Tbhq, Wheat
What is a Dairy Free diet?
A dairy-free diet eliminates all foods made from or containing milk and milk-derived ingredients, such as butter, cheese, yogurt, and cream. It's essential for people with lactose intolerance, milk allergies, or those who prefer plant-based alternatives. Common dairy substitutes include almond, soy, oat, and coconut-based milks and cheeses. While dairy is a major source of calcium and vitamin D, these nutrients can be replaced through fortified foods or supplements. Many people find going dairy-free helps reduce digestive issues, acne, or inflammation, but balance and proper nutrient intake remain key for long-term health.
